Warehouse space for lease refers to the availability of commercial storage centers that can be leased by services or people for the purpose of storing items or inventory. These spaces can differ in size and place, and are usually leased for a set period of time.

  • When looking for warehouse space for rent, it is very important to consider the area of the storage facility. Aspects such as proximity to major highways, airports, and ports can considerably impact the effectiveness of transport and logistics operations.
  • Another important factor to consider is the size and layout of the storage facility. Depending upon the kind of products being stored or the operations being performed, particular warehouse setups may be more suitable than others. For example, a warehouse with high ceilings and adequate flooring area may be necessary for saving large devices or machinery.
  • The condition of the warehouse is also a crucial factor to consider. Elements such as the age of the building, the quality of the construction, and the presence of any ecological hazards can all affect the safety and functionality of the space.
  • In addition to the physical qualities of the storage facility, it is necessary to think about the regards to the lease agreement. Elements such as the length of the lease, the rental rate, and any additional costs or charges can all affect the general expense and feasibility of renting the space.
  • Finally, it is essential to consider the level of assistance and services offered by the landlord or property management business. Elements such as maintenance and repair services, security steps, and access to packing docks and other features can all impact the ease and performance of running within the warehouse space.

Gauging the Adequacy of a Logistics Hub for Your Commercial Prerequisites

When evaluating the suitability of a storage facility area for your company needs, there are numerous elements to consider. To start with, you need to assess the racking system and guarantee that it can accommodate your inventory. Secondly, you require to examine the security system, including CCTV surveillance and access control, to make sure that your items are safe. Thirdly, you require to validate the existence of a fire suppression system to secure your stock from fire damage. Furthermore, you require to check the accessibility of dock levelers for simple loading and discharging of items. Additionally, you might need to lease forklifts and other material handling equipment to facilitate your operations. Lastly, you require to make sure that the warehouse has appropriate facilities for packaging and labeling, in addition to shipping and receiving. By thinking about these aspects, you can assess the viability of a storage facility space for your business requirements.

The Ins and Outs of Signing a Lease for Distribution Center Space: Best Practices and Pitfalls

When negotiating a lease agreement for storage facility area, it is essential to bear in mind the dos and do n'ts. First of all, it is crucial to have a clear understanding of your business requirements and requirements, such as order fulfillment, inventory tracking, pick and pack, reverse logistics, supply chain management, just-in-time delivery, freight transportation, last-mile delivery, carrier services, and freight brokerage. Secondly, it is very important to negotiate the conditions of the lease contract, consisting of the length of the lease, lease, security deposit, maintenance responsibilities, and any additional costs. Finally, it is vital to have a comprehensive understanding of the legal implications of the lease contract and seek legal recommendations if needed. On the other hand, it is necessary to avoid rushing into a lease arrangement without correct research study and due diligence, as well as signing a lease agreement without totally comprehending the terms and conditions.

  • Comprehending the significance of completely looking into the market and equivalent homes in order to work out the best possible lease terms and rates.
  • Knowing how to efficiently interact with property owners and property supervisors to construct a positive relationship and develop trust throughout the negotiation process.
  • Being able to determine prospective mistakes and warnings in lease arrangements, such as covert charges or undesirable stipulations, and negotiating to have them gotten rid of or amended.
  • Understanding the legal and monetary implications of various lease structures, such as triple net leases or gross leases, and being able to work out terms that align with the occupant's organization goals and budget.
  • Knowing how to leverage market conditions and the proprietor's inspirations to negotiate favorable lease terms, such as lease abatements, renter improvement allowances, or choices to restore or broaden the lease.

Name Description
NAIOP The leading organization for developers, owners, and investors of industrial, office, and related commercial real estate.
BOMA International The Building Owners and Managers Association International is a federation of more than 90 local associations representing the owners and managers of commercial properties.
IREM The Institute of Real Estate Management is an international community of real estate managers dedicated to ethical business practices, maximizing the value of investment real estate, and promoting superior management through education and information sharing.
SIOR The Society of Industrial and Office Realtors is the leading professional commercial and industrial real estate association.
CCIM The CCIM Institute is a global community of commercial real estate professionals who have earned the CCIM designation, which represents the highest level of expertise, knowledge, and professionalism in the industry.
